My iphone has started to develop a small crack (which i assume will get bigger in time) in the casing near to the charging port at the bottom.

Is there anything i can do to get this fixed?

My iphone is covered under applecare
 
I think it happens, i know a few people who have had the same problem and they've all looked after their phones. It is what i consider to be a weak point on the phone
 
yeh its a common problem. If its still covered under warranty or applecare they will fix/swap it for you.

My white 3GS (18 months old) now has about 15 tiny cracks at the bottom
 
I have the exact problem with my 3GS and got it replaced by Apple with minimum fuzz. Make an appointment with the bar (Genius) first.

Apple will actually replace your iPhone out of warranty for this issue.

2 of my friends have had theirs replaced this way.

This is true, I've swapped out mine, my Dad's and two of my friend's for this issue. It's a known fault. Just drop into an apple store and they should sort it for you. If they don't, visit another one!
